Pig Pals! 🐽 [2 Player Obby] is an obby experience created on 2025-04-10. The game has accumulated 2,511,301 lifetime visits and 50,967 favorites. It currently has 2 players online. The experience holds a 98% like percentage. The description highlights a two-player cooperative adventure involving a tail tether mechanic and a boss update featuring a chef.
